The weather data that's offered now is plenty in my opinion...all I really want is doppler, temp, and wind...if I need more detail I'll use my phone and one of the several weather apps on it...PYKL3 Radar is all any amatuer meteorologist could ever want in a phone app...but its a little much for a GPS unit...just trying to say, no need to go overboard...the GPS doesn't have the brain power to handle it.
That said...getting with a reliable weather source for the GPS is still important because the whole idea is reliable weather at your fingertips with as little distraction from the road as possible. I recommended the sources I did because their weather apps are fairly accurate and they appear to be here to stay. There are a few 3rd party weather widgets out there that pull their data from from these sources already...so I figured it would be an easy thing for RM to do...but I may be wrong, because I have no idea what's involved, lol.

Ridgerunner665;3294301, I hear you. I just don't like the static radar picture nor the long refresh rate. I was in a t-storm warning and tornado watch area today and the weather page and radar picture showed sunny skies while quarter sized hail pounded my truck. Okay this is NOT an RM issue, this is a provider issue. So I think RM needs a better provider. I'd really like to see watches, warnings and advisories flash on the map page when they are received without having to manually look up the weather report page and I'd like to see some animation with the radar. But, I think for RM to even think about this, they have to change providers. Like I posted, I'll even consider paying for it if it's really good.
